Acknow (ak*nō") , transitive verb

[Prefix a- + know; Anglo-Saxon oncnāwan.]

1.
To recognize. [Obsolete]
You will not be acknown, sir. — B. Jonson
2.
To acknowledge; to confess. [Obsolete] — Chaucer
We say of a stubborn body that standeth still in the denying of his fault, This man will not acknowledge his fault, or, He will not be acknown of his fault. — Sir T. More
